Title :
An advance dynamic resource reservation algorithm for OBS networks: Design and performance

Abstract :
This paper aims at studying the impact of the parameters subject to variability in the transmission of traffic in an OBS network. It provides techniques allowing better resources´ use based on user satisfaction and profile. It describes an advance reservation scheme for OBS networks that copes with the uncertainty of the QoS requirements specified at connection establishment. Our method attempts to increase the utilization of resources such as bandwidth and wavelengths.
